Overview

The Core i5-13500E is manufactured by Intel. It was released in 4 January 2023 (2 years ago). It is based on the Raptor Lake-S (2023−2024) architecture. It features 14 cores and 20 threads. Base frequency is 2.4 GHz, with boost up to 4.6 GHz. L3 cache: 24 MB (total). L2 cache: 1.25 MB (per core). Built on 10 nm process technology. Socket: LGA1700. Thermal design power (TDP): 65 Watt. Memory support: DDR4, DDR5 Dual-channel. Passmark benchmark score: 24,096 points. Launch price was $299.

Processing Power

The Core i5-13500E is a 14-core / 20-thread processor based on the Raptor Lake-S (2023−2024) architecture, manufactured on a 10 nm process node. It reaches a maximum boost clock of 4.6 GHz from a base frequency of 2.4 GHz— higher boost clocks directly translate to better single-threaded performance and responsiveness in gaming. It carries 24 MB (total) of L3 cache, plus 1.25 MB (per core) of L2 cache and 80K (per core) of L1 cache per core. In the PassMark benchmark (a comprehensive multi-threaded test), it scores 24,096, placing it in the Mid-Range performance tier as a Recent generation product. Geekbench 6 single-core (the most relevant metric for gaming FPS) records 1,862, while multi-core reaches 14,166. Cinebench R23 multi-core (measuring sustained rendering workload performance) scores 21,216.

Memory & Platform

The Core i5-13500E fits into the LGA1700 socket and supports PCIe 5.0 with 20 total PCIe lanes for expansion cards and storage. It supports DDR4, DDR5 Dual-channel memory at speeds up to DDR5-4800 (faster RAM improves bandwidth-sensitive workloads), with a maximum capacity of 128 GB across 2 channels (dual-channel doubles bandwidth). It supports ECC memory, providing error-correcting capabilities — essential for mission-critical workloads and servers. Integrated graphics: UHD Graphics 770 — allows display output without a dedicated GPU, useful for troubleshooting and light tasks.

Power & Cooling

The Core i5-13500E has a rated TDP (Thermal Design Power) of 65 Watt — this indicates the amount of heat generated under sustained load and determines what cooling solution is needed. No stock cooler is included — you will need to purchase an aftermarket cooler separately. Recommended cooling: Air Cooler 120mm+.
